Summary

Noel Shannon, a 40‑year‑old electrician from Finglas, pleaded guilty to disclosing personal data from a Garda intelligence board that contained information on 108 people. He photographed the board while working on emergency lighting at Kilmainham Garda Station in March 2019, later sending the images to two other electricians. The pictures were subsequently circulated on social media. The case was the first criminal breach of the Data Protection Act 2018 prosecuted on indictment. Judge Melanie Greally found no premeditation or malice, noting the offence was committed while intoxicated. She imposed a headline sentence of three years but, considering mitigating factors such as his early guilty plea, remorse, stable family and work life, she suspended a two‑year custodial term in full for two years. The court recorded that Shannon had four prior convictions, including theft and a public order offence. The prosecution and defence agreed that Shannon had not foreseen the consequences of his actions.
